The Empress

A figure sits in a luxurious chair in a field of tall grass. Embracing their own femininity and sexuality, they are able to enjoy the beauty around them as it unfolds.

FertilityAbundanceNatureNurturing

You have cultivated something wonderful through a connection to your inner divine and nature. Appreciate the beauty and passion that you attract.

You are not attracting the beauty and passion you want. Perhaps you are impatient or perhaps you must connect more with nature or your own raw energy.

You planted something from a place of real connection, and it grew. The Empress in the past points to a season where you let yourself enjoy what you made — your body, your home, your creative work, a relationship. Whatever abundance you're drawing on now traces back to that rooted, unhurried version of you.

There's more around you than you're letting yourself feel. The Empress in the present asks you to slow down enough to actually receive — the beauty, the care, the pleasure that's already here. You don't have to earn softness; you have to make room for it.

What's unfolding wants to be cultivated, not chased. The Empress in the future points to a slow bloom — creative, relational, or literal — that asks for nurture rather than force. Tend to your own ground and the abundance follows.
